i had worked there since close to their opening. i was a break in dealer, the staff there in the pit taught me much about the industry. they pride themselves on service to patrons at all costs.
it is a smaller place than many, but the small town feel is refreshing to me. as for the security staff, they have many facets to their responsibilities: they are not armed, there are 2 sherrifs for the 35 mile long salton sea beach area so therefor must stay on their toes most all the time, the tribal guys i worked with were really good people, i worked another casino, once i left there, and would see them come in and play from time to time and they were always very nice to everyone. the security staff is comprised of everything from retired police and corrections officers, to ex military personel, to newbies as well. these guys (and gals) take orders from tribal people, to surveillance people, to pit bosses, and they are very in tune with their responsibilities even though they have many things to be watchful of.(as does any casino) my experiences there were good, and my players always had a good time playing at my tables. you see: gaming security issues are sometimes more needed at a smaller, newer place, with many breakin dealers, since players who may try to cheat find it a target, thinking "this little casino has no clue". So they need be on their toes and watchful of new faces for many reasons. but anyone who says their experience was less than enjoyable, because of security personel observing them, might need reconsider their own actions when in such an establishment. I found my co-workers to be awesome to work with, and very sincere, and good folks to work with. im glad for the experiences and friends i made there. I know this casino will do very well, even in these more financially challenging times. go BET ON RED. My best to the TM tribe and the casino as well. |
